Convert the following measurement. \[ 9.1 \times 10^{2} \frac{\mathrm{~kg}}{\mathrm{~m}^{3}}=\square \frac{\mathrm{g}}{\mathrm{cm}^{3}} \]

Answer

The measurement \( 9.1 \times 10^{2} \frac{\mathrm{~kg}}{\mathrm{~m}^{3}} \) is equal to \( 0.91 \frac{\mathrm{g}}{\mathrm{cm}^{3}} \).

Solution

Calculate the value by following steps: - step0: Calculate: \(\frac{9.1\times 10^{2}\left(\frac{1000}{1}\right)}{100^{3}}\) - step1: Divide the terms: \(\frac{9.1\times 10^{2}\times 1000}{100^{3}}\) - step2: Multiply: \(\frac{9.1\times 10^{5}}{100^{3}}\) - step3: Factor the expression: \(\frac{9.1\times 10^{5}}{10^{6}}\) - step4: Reduce the fraction: \(\frac{9.1}{10}\) - step5: Convert the expressions: \(\frac{\frac{91}{10}}{10}\) - step6: Multiply by the reciprocal: \(\frac{91}{10}\times \frac{1}{10}\) - step7: Multiply the fractions: \(\frac{91}{10\times 10}\) - step8: Multiply: \(\frac{91}{100}\) To convert the measurement \( 9.1 \times 10^{2} \frac{\mathrm{~kg}}{\mathrm{~m}^{3}} \) to \( \frac{\mathrm{g}}{\mathrm{cm}^{3}} \), we can follow these steps: 1. **Understand the conversion factors**: - \( 1 \, \mathrm{kg} = 1000 \, \mathrm{g} \) - \( 1 \, \mathrm{m}^{3} = 100^3 \, \mathrm{cm}^{3} = 1,000,000 \, \mathrm{cm}^{3} \) 2. **Set up the conversion**: \[ 9.1 \times 10^{2} \frac{\mathrm{kg}}{\mathrm{m}^{3}} = 9.1 \times 10^{2} \frac{1000 \, \mathrm{g}}{1 \, \mathrm{kg}} \cdot \frac{1 \, \mathrm{m}^{3}}{1,000,000 \, \mathrm{cm}^{3}} \] 3. **Calculate the conversion**: \[ = 9.1 \times 10^{2} \cdot \frac{1000}{1,000,000} \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} = 9.1 \times 10^{2} \cdot \frac{1}{1000} \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} = 9.1 \times 10^{-1} \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} \] 4. **Final result**: \[ 9.1 \times 10^{-1} \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} = 0.91 \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} \] Thus, the converted measurement is: \[ 0.91 \, \frac{\mathrm{g}}{\mathrm{cm}^{3}} \]

To convert \( 9.1 \times 10^{2} \frac{\mathrm{~kg}}{\mathrm{~m}^{3}} \) to \( \frac{\mathrm{g}}{\mathrm{cm}^{3}} \), we can use the fact that \( 1 \, \mathrm{kg/m^3} = 0.001 \, \mathrm{g/cm^3} \). So, we multiply \( 9.1 \times 10^{2} \, \mathrm{kg/m^3} \) by \( 0.001 \): \[ 9.1 \times 10^{2} \times 0.001 = 9.1 \times 10^{-1} \, \mathrm{g/cm^3} = 0.91 \, \mathrm{g/cm^3} \] Thus, \[ 9.1 \times 10^{2} \frac{\mathrm{~kg}}{\mathrm{~m}^{3}} = 0.91 \frac{\mathrm{g}}{\mathrm{cm}^{3}} \]
